Platinum Software Purchases Publisher

Platinum Software Corp. said Monday that it has purchased a publisher of accounting software for the Australian and New Zealand markets. Terms of the agreement were not disclosed.

Platinum, based in Irvine, specializes in software for financial operations and manufacturing processes. The company raised about $20 million with its initial public stock offering in October.

The acquisition of New Zealand’s Automation One is the 8-year-old company’s second purchase since then. In December, Platinum bought Systems Engineering Assn., a small Bloomington Hills, Mich., firm that helped it develop its proprietary accounting software.

Automation One, founded in 1983, provides financial management and accounting software for small to mid-size companies across New Zealand and Australia. The company, which employs 75, has more than 10,000 customers serviced by a network of offices in both countries.

Platinum, with about 250 employees, markets its products to more than 40,000 customers worldwide.

Platinum has not yet completed a full year as a publicly traded company. For the first nine months of its 1993 fiscal year, the company reported a profit of $1.8 million on sales of $22.9 million.
